3-CHLORO-6,6A-DIHYDRO-1AH-1-OXA-CYCLOPROPA[A]INDENE

Description:
3-Chloro-6,6A-dihydro-1H-1-oxa-cyclopropa[a]indene, with the CAS number 116540-88-6, is a chemical compound characterized by its unique bicyclic structure that incorporates a cyclopropane and an oxirane moiety. This compound features a chlorine substituent at the 3-position, which can influence its reactivity and interaction with biological systems. The presence of the oxirane ring contributes to its potential as a reactive intermediate in organic synthesis. The dihydro configuration indicates that the compound has two hydrogen atoms added to the bicyclic framework, affecting its stability and reactivity. Generally, compounds of this type may exhibit interesting pharmacological properties, making them of interest in medicinal chemistry. However, specific properties such as solubility, melting point, and spectral characteristics would require empirical data for precise determination. As with many halogenated compounds, safety and handling precautions are essential due to potential toxicity and environmental impact.
Formula:C9H7ClO
